Flames open 2018-19 regular season on October 3

In advance of the annual unveiling of the entire regular season calendar, the National Hockey League and its clubs have announced the 31 home openers. The Calgary Flames factor into three of those dates, with their regular season schedule beginning on Oct. 3.
The Flames will begin their season on the road on Wed., Oct. 3 against the Vancouver Canucks. They’ll be opening their home schedule at the Saddledome on Sat., Oct. 6 against the Canucks – it’s presumably the late game on Hockey Night in Canada at 8 p.m. MT, so hopefully there will be fun and revelry outside to lead up to the game. And they’ll be featured in Nashville’s home opener on Tues., Oct. 9.
The Flames’ entire 82-game schedule will be announced by the league tomorrow at 3 p.m. MT. Since the season begins on Oct. 3, the NHL’s annual roster deadline (by which clubs need to be down to a cap-compliant 23 bodies) will be Tues., Oct. 2 at 3 p.m. MT.
